Prepping Your Surfaces



Effectively preparing your surfaces is crucial to achieving a remarkable troubled paint look in your home. The initial step in prepping your surfaces is to ensure they are tidy and devoid of any type of dust, grease, or old paint. Make use of a light detergent or a degreaser to extensively clean up the surfaces and permit them to completely dry completely prior to proceeding.

After cleaning, check the surface areas for any kind of flaws such as cracks, openings, or uneven areas. Fill in any type of splits or openings with spackling substance and sand down any rough spots to produce a smooth base for the paint.

Next off, it is necessary to prime your surface areas prior to applying the distressed paint. Primer assists the paint stick far better to the surface and supplies a consistent base for the paint shade. Choose a primer that is suitable for the surface area you are working with, whether it's wood, steel, or drywall.

Lastly, consider sanding the surfaces lightly to produce a slightly harsh texture that will enhance the distressed appearance of the paint. Sand along the sides and edges where natural damage would strike simulate an aged appearance.

Stressful Techniques & Tips



To attain a genuine troubled paint look in your home, mastering different stressful methods and integrating functional pointers is necessary.

One reliable strategy is dry brushing, which involves using a percentage of paint to a completely dry brush and lightly sweeping it over the surface area to create a weathered impact.

One more preferred technique is fining sand, where sandpaper is used to delicately eliminate layers of paint, exposing the underlying colors and adding a worn look.

For a much more rustic look, think about utilizing a crackle tool between coats of paint to achieve a broken finish evocative aged paint.

In addition to these techniques, there are some vital ideas to keep in mind when stressful paint.

Begin with a base coat in a different shade to make certain that it glimpses with when traumatic.

Experiment with different tools such as sandpaper, steel wool, and even a damp cloth to accomplish varying degrees of distress.

Remember to concentrate on high-traffic locations and edges where all-natural deterioration would happen.

Last but not least, practice on a little example board prior to applying traumatic methods to your whole surface to excellent your wanted look.
